手写游戏程序需要掌握以下几个关键步骤:
确定游戏类型和玩法
明确游戏的核心玩法,例如是动作游戏、策略游戏还是其他类型。
设计游戏的基本规则和目标。
设计游戏界面和角色形象
使用HTML和CSS创建游戏的基本布局和界面元素。
设计游戏的角色和背景,确保它们吸引人且符合游戏主题。
编写游戏逻辑
使用JavaScript或其他编程语言实现游戏逻辑。
定义游戏对象、状态和事件处理函数。
实现游戏循环,确保游戏能够持续运行。
实现游戏功能
编写代码实现游戏的各个功能,如玩家输入处理、电脑AI、碰撞检测等。
确保游戏逻辑流畅且无bug。
测试和调试
在不同设备和浏览器上测试游戏,确保兼容性和稳定性。
使用调试工具查找并修复代码中的错误。
优化和发布
对游戏进行性能优化,提高运行效率和用户体验。
准备发布所需的文件,如图片、音频等。
发布游戏到适当的平台,如网页、移动应用等。
HTML (index.html)
```html